Description
Key Features
Explore diverse praxes of poetry that help build community around students, language, and writing practices.
Engage with new textual forms and various methods of text-mediated learning within academic settings.
Examine multiform poetry through a lens that traverses Asia, the Atlantic, and virtual spaces.
Connect different disciplines and genres through a collection of intersecting academic trajectories.
Expand traditional teaching and learning paradigms by integrating diverse poetic perspectives and forms.
